Understanding the Mechanics Behind the Reels

Slot machines, whether physical or digital, rely on random number generators. But randomness does not mean every spin has an equal shot at the top prize. Jackpot truth often reveals that the biggest prizes are tightly connected to bet sizes, game volatility, and specific payline configurations. For instance, some games require maximum bets to qualify for progressive jackpots, while others spread the odds more evenly across different wager levels. Common Misconceptions About Jackpots

One of the biggest myths floating around is that slots are “due” to hit after a long dry spell. That is simply not how random number generators work. Each spin is independent, and past results have no bearing on future outcomes. Another misconception is that progressive jackpots are impossible to win unless you bet the maximum. While many progressives do require top-tier bets, some newer systems allow smaller wagers to share in a fraction of the pool. A reliable slots exposed analysis will clarify these points without hype. The honest truth is that luck is a factor, but informed choices dramatically improve the odds of having a positive experience, even if you do not hit the life-changing prize.

Are progressive jackpots always better than fixed ones?

Not necessarily. Progressives offer larger potential prizes but often require maximum bets and have lower base game RTP. Fixed jackpots might be smaller but can trigger more frequently and with lower bankroll risk.

Can I rely solely on RTP percentages?

RTP is important, but it does not tell the whole story. Volatility, hit frequency, and bonus mechanics all affect how a game performs in real sessions. Combine RTP with other factors for a complete picture.

What is the most overlooked detail in slot design?

Many players ignore the minimum bet requirements for triggering certain features. Always check if a bonus round or progressive jackpot requires a specific wager level before you start spinning.
